Yucai Su Xiaoping Xu

In this paper, we determine the isomorphism classes of the central simple Poisson algebras introduced earlier by the second author. The Lie algebra structures of these Poisson algebras are in general not finitely-graded.

LI GUO

We describe a general framework to define dendriform algebras and a general construction to obtain new dendriform algebra structures from known structures and from linear operators. The construction includes recent constructions of the quadri-algebra, the ennea-algebras, the dendriformNijenhuis algebras and the octo-algebras.

Pascal Lefèvre

We compute the essential norm of a composition operator relatively to the class of Dunford-Pettis opertors or weakly compact operators, on some uniform algebras of analytic functions. Even in the frame of H∞ (resp. the disk algebra), this is new, as well for the polydisk algebras and the polyball algebras. This is a consequence of a general study of weighted composition operators.
